
SCS Global Services (SCS), a third-party environmental and sustainability certification services company, said Welspun Flooring Limited has become the first company to achieve certification under its new Zero Waste Standard.
This new global certification standard allows companies to demonstrate the degree to which their waste streams are prevented, reused or diverted from landfills. SCS’ independent certification audit, including on-site inspection, confirmed that Welspun Flooring’s Telangana, India, manufacturing facility has achieved 98 percent diversion of waste from landfill through a combination of recycling, waste reclamation, co-processing, composting and storage.
The resulting certification captures the extent of the company’s efforts to become better stewards of facility wastes. In addition, SCS said Welspun Flooring “assiduously tracks the progress of its waste minimization and diversion accomplishments” through internal recordkeeping, which in turn supports its goal to inform the public of its sustainable waste commitments and its ongoing commitment to environmental, social and governance (ESG) performance goals.

Savlani said when SCS launched its Zero Waste Certification program a few months ago, the company saw it as an opportunity to certify and validate its extensive waste diversion program.

Headquartered in Emeryville, Calif., SCS has representatives and affiliate offices throughout the Americas, Asia/Pacific, Europe and Africa. SCS is a chartered Benefit Corporation, reflecting its commitment to socially and environmentally responsible business practices.
Welspun Flooring is a vertically integrated flooring solutions provider based in Telangana, India. Welspun Flooring is part of the Welspun Group, one of India’s fastest growing global conglomerates with businesses that include home textiles, advanced textiles and flooring.
